| | | Re: Spider for ID please I would say Pisaura mirabilis as well, Dave.
They can be a bit variable in colouration and the angle of your photo is making the fore legs appear a bit short, like some species of Pardosa, but those large closely spaced eyes say Pisaura to me. Pardosa eyes tend to be more widely spaced. |
